Identity, ProfileLimeExchange understands the nuances of a highly competitive Freelance & Online Services Outsourcing market and calls out the following 10 steps from its experience and feedback, to help you differentiate yourself, gain better visibility/responses and better your chances of sharing & earning via LimeExchange:

1. Create your Detailed Profile - “Your Profile represents your online Identity“. Try and provide as much detail as possible about yourself, your experience, skills, certifications and education to help users gauge your competencies realistically.

2. Profile Portfolio - Emphasis should be given in attaching a detailed portfolio of your past work, certain references, which would help increase your credibility. Invite Friends, Colleagues to create your Business Network to provide credible references.

3. Profile Image - It always helps for a online user to relate with a Photograph/Picture and put a face to a name. A Picture speaks a thousand words, so rather than using Icon’s use your profile photo and help establish a credibility to your online user name.

4. Profile Video - Very relevant to SMB’s (Small Medium Business) to showcase their office, Infrastructure and Team. Showcase any Corporate Flash Video (If published on YouTube) helps you provide any user with attractive medium information about your organization

6. Relate to Categories - If you require or provide services in more than one category, then update your profile and add all relevant categories to your profile. This helps you participate in your relevant service categories.

7. Detail your Requirement/Bid - When posting a project or bidding on a project, provide as much references, relevant information to enable either party to understand each others requirement better. Try and answer the questions on What? Why? When? How? How Much? within the content of your post. Just having this information reduces the overhead communication, builds a level of confidence in one’s abilities to collaborate and enhances everyone’s experience.

8. Define Business Agreement (Terms of Engagement) - At any time during Bidding stage, try and provide as much detail on Scope of Work, Cost and Timelines. Create a Draft in LimeExchange and tailor it for every Bid to relate to the project requirement. Any Buyer of services wants to ensure first hand information about Cost & Schedule and this goes a long way in establishing trust with the Buyer.

9. Define Milestones - Within Business Agreement or Terms of Engagement, ensure along with Bid, Milestones are clearly defined with corresponding schedule and payment terms. Again as much information to a Buyer on Cost and Schedule implications involved helps build a mutually beneficial relationship.
